The Innovation of 3D Printed Camera Accessories

3D printing technology has not only revolutionized camera bodies but also camera accessories. The use of 3D printing allows for the creation of innovative and customized camera accessories that enhance the functionality and versatility of cameras. From lens hoods and filters to tripod mounts and flash diffusers, photographers can now design and print their own accessories to suit their specific needs.

One example of an innovative 3D printed camera accessory is the lens adapter. Traditional cameras often have limitations when it comes to using lenses from different manufacturers. However, with 3D printed lens adapters, photographers can easily mount lenses from different brands onto their cameras, expanding their options and creative possibilities.
